Output 368dfc2d72d193bc1f2c8b6eb0cb89d8f3215bc8a3d0c4882c53dad96739e1f7:2

value
1698128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b1074039d0665a6fa42c520ab89ca5cfa378fad OP_EQUAL
address
375KW3nEYw3mX65hqAJFfuYTQRJHLRfNJJ
transaction
368dfc2d72d193bc1f2c8b6eb0cb89d8f3215bc8a3d0c4882c53dad96739e1f7
spent
true